Across TCGA patient cohorts, PGM1 mutation is significantly associated with the RNA expression of many other genes, with 3,900 significant associations in total. UCEC shows the largest number of these associations.
The most reproducible PGM1-associated genes across cancer lineages are NPAP1P2, FEN1, and PPP2R2D. Each is linked with PGM1 in more than 2 cancer types. Because this analysis shows association rather than direction, both PGM1-to-partner and partner-to-PGM1 results are reported.
